Question Unique Cobra Shocks

Has anyone used kyb shocks on the old style front end on the Unique 427 ? If not what shocks do you recommend ? Make and model number if possible. I am not ready to change out the entire front end yet, just want to replace shocks.

Are you looking at one of the lever shock conversion kits? For all around use you will see a difference. Just disabling the lever shocks and going to practically and tube shock was an overall improvement for me. One of the conversion kits made just for it will be better. For around $1300 Hawk makes a great replacement front end for the MG that will use you kingpins and swivel axles with an adjustable coil over suspension.

If you haven't done so already, I updated the girling/GM front brakes to wilwood with very good results. Do a search and you will find the details on how to.

Also, check the Unique forum for a new rack lay out. The bump steer is obsurd in the MG front. Although I think a conversation with Hawk may yield some alternatives.

Moss has anti-roll bars cheap and one of the guys on the Unique forum is going through some pretty extensive tuning that you may find of help.
